Mundaring Shire Pre-Season Forum - Saturday 19th October

DFES and the Shire of Mundaring have this year put together a Pre-Season Forum.

The forum will be held on Saturday 19th October at the Mundaring Arena, starting at 0900hrs and concluding 1200 hrs and followed by a light lunch.

The presentations will cover:

  • Bushfire Investigation - DFES Fire Investigation Unit;
  • Statement and evidence gathering - Shire of Mundaring Community Safety;
  • Wellness self-care, identifying someone who may not be travelling well - DFES wellness department;
  • Weather and the impacts for bushfire behaviour - RFD Bushfire Technical Service;

The forum is open for all mundaring member of the Bush Fire Service, State Emergancy Service and Fire and Rescue Service.
